How was the lotto number prediction made by Derren Brown?

The first show, a live event that was broadcast on September 9, 2009, seemed to show Derren Brown calling the results of the lottery that evening. The live draw was conducted using a set of white balls that were arranged in a line, facing the wall, adjacent to a television showing a live broadcast from BBC One. Brown recorded the results on a piece of paper after the draw and then turned the white balls around to face the camera to show that the numbers on the balls and the numbers on the card were identical. These were the lucky numbers: 2, 11, 23, 28, 35, and 39. His forecasts omitted the bonus ball, which was number 15, but the bonus was.

A second show that day, on Friday, September 11, at 21:00, included three lottery winning scenarios. The first, pretending to have a winning ticket, was swiftly disproved, and the bulk of the program focused on Brown’s use of crowd psychology and automatic writing to appear to anticipate the numbers. Brown proposed that he may have anticipated numbers utilizing a phenomena known as the “Wisdom of Crowds” through a series of experiments and efforts to explain complex psychology without addressing the underlying math. He showed a group of 24 volunteers who had appeared to predict the right numbers over the course of several sessions by looking at a board with past lottery results and making an educated guess using automatic writing. The program came to a close with a quick explanation of how the lottery results might have been manipulated. Brown insisted that doing so would have been against the law and that he would always insist that the stunt was just a prank.

Leading academics and the press both criticized the “Wisdom of Crowds” argument harshly, with one journalist noting in The Times that “Derren Brown shifts from the most engaging man on television to the most obnoxious.” The ploy would have “placed millions onvalue in the years to come,” according to publicist Max Clifford. The hour-long “explanation,” according to philosopher A. C. Grayling, “was itself a trick, and not as good as the lottery trick itself.” The National Lottery’s operator, Camelot, praised Brown for his “illusion” and emphasized to the general public that it was “impossible to alter the outcome of the draw.” This ruse garnered a lot of interest, and several alternate explanations, such as the employment of a split-screen camera trick or a false wall, were put out. According to a poll conducted for the Guardian, a split screen is most likely. Captain Disillusion, a YouTube skeptic and visual effects expert, provided a plausible explanation for the trick, explaining how a motion-controlled camera might carry out perfectly timed motions while enabling a portion of the picture to be blocked off to disguise a helper setting the numbered balls.
